Mini Modular Mech by Kmech Toys

Mech the Halls (Source: Kmech Toys via Printables)
Finished “Armored Core VI” and looking for a new challenge? Why not print and assemble this detailed 1/18-scale mech model, with 40 modular components (think shields, guns, and cables) that allow you to tack on your preferred robotic flair.

The model as a whole is compatible with the many other mech-adjacent prints – robotic dogs and an ornithopter from “Dune” are noteworthy examples here – available on Kmech Toys’ Printables profile, so be sure to check those out if you’re ready for more gear-grinding action.
